Neomedetera

Genus of flies From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Neomedetera is a genus of flies belonging to the family Dolichopodidae.[2] It contains only a single species, Neomedetera membranacea, described from China.[1] It is placed in the subfamily Medeterinae, tribe Udzungwomyiini.[3]
